What you'll do:

As a Procurement Officer, your role will be integral in supporting the team's daily procurement activities. You'll be responsible for managing documents, engaging with stakeholders, ensuring pipeline visibility, and conducting market research. Additionally, you'll take minutes for Sourcing Committee meetings. Your role will also provide you with development opportunities such as shadowing contract negotiations and supplier briefings, and potentially leading low-risk, lower-value procurement opportunities.

- Manage and organise important documents
- Engage with stakeholders to draft documents and respond to supplier clarifications
- Ensure pipeline visibility by prompting stakeholders on deadlines
- Take minutes for Sourcing Committee meetings
- Shadow contract negotiations and supplier briefings
- Potentially lead low-risk, lower-value procurement opportunities such as simple and non-complex RFQs

What you bring:

The ideal candidate for this Procurement Officer position brings a wealth of experience in procurement or a similar role. Your strong interpersonal skills will enable you to effectively engage with stakeholders, while your excellent organisational skills will ensure efficient document management. Your ability to conduct thorough market research will be crucial in this role. Experience in taking meeting minutes is also required. Above all, your willingness to learn and develop new skills will set you apart.

- Proven experience in procurement or a similar role
- Ability to conduct thorough market research
- Experience in taking meeting minutes
- Willingness to learn and develop new skills
